It has been two months since I started this "project" and it definitely started off a little rough. I have replaced the power jack and the laptop is functioning properly.......whew. In the end I was able to take some needle nose pliers and gently remove the pins from the remaining solder. I then cleaned out the holes and soldered the new jack in place.
